Eastwood accepts ‘Gauntlet,’ runs with it

Actor, producer and writer Clint Eastwood came through Boulder City for a 1977 film titled “The Gauntlet.” While Eastwood was always on board to direct the Warner Bros. picture, he wasn’t the first or second choice to star in the film.

Boulder Theatre to open its doors to events

Whether as a location for builders of Hoover Dam to escape the heat, a place to see movies with families, friends or a date, or a venue to enjoy ballet performances, the Boulder Theatre has been a favorite local historical landmark for nearly a century.
